>> Do you mean you want to plug more devices into your router than it has
>> ports? If so just look for a 5-port or 8-port desktop switch
>> which all companies make, Linksys, D-Link, Netgear etc.
>> You use one of the ports of your router (most of them have 4 ports) and
>> plug
>> in the desktop switch and then you have those 5 or 8
>> ports available (depending on which one you buy). I have a Cisco 16-port
>> small business switch at my store which has 8 regular and 8
>> POE ports power over ethernet, those are ports used for example if you
>> have
>> Ip phones which need the network connection but also
>> require power). Often you can power POE devices with a separate adapter,
>> but
>> if you have POE ports on your router the CAD5E or CAD6
>> cable provides the power for the device as well as the wired connection
>> to
>> your network
